Britain’s Got Talent 2011: Edward Reid makes a nursery rhyme out of Leona Lewis’ Run!
Thirty-five-year-old drama teacher Edward turned up to this year’s Britain’s Got Talent auditions in Glasgow and told Ant and Dec:
“I teach a group called the Nifty Fifties which are pensioners. I teach them drama, which is a fantastic class. I like working with people with special needs, they seem to have amazing personalities. Somehow they have no inhibitions, so all the classes are always funny and entertaining. I used to work in a day centre and i used to walk about singing all the time and someone said to me, ‘You’ve got a nice voice,’ and I’ve never heard that before.
He added:
“I think Britain’s Got Talent would change my life. Just the fact that I’m here, this’ll be the biggest audience I’ve ever sung in front of. If I got to perform at the Royal Variety Performance in front of the Queen, those five minutes in her presence would be amazing.”
Edward then performed his own ‘original’ take on Leona Lewis’ Run for the panel and has the whole crowd in stitches of laughter.
Afterwards, Michael exclaimed: “Thoroughly entertaining, thoroughly surprising, I didn’t think it would come in this form but Glasgow’s got talent.”
